Ticket #4471 — Test vault locked again (PayBridge integration suite)

Hey new folks, welcome to a classic. The PayBridge integration tests went red overnight, but it's not the flakiness this time — the sandbox credentials vault auto-locked after three bad fetch attempts from the retry-happy settlement tests. Fix the retry cap first (see the runner config), then unlock the vault so the suite can pull creds. The unlock phrase is below.

vault phrase of bagaf-kajeg = jorath-feniel-briir-siliel-ralix

- [ ] **Step 7 — Re-seal the Tailspout signing key.** After generating the release key for the Tailspout log-tailing CLI, confirm both witnesses have signed the ceremony record, then place the key shard in the offline vault. The vault's escrow slot must be initialized with the recovery passphrase below.

strongbox words: zorwyn-sorael-belion-ulaius-silmir-ulays-briax-rusdor-gorix

Ticket: Config drift on Pictor image cache nodes

The memory leak on the Pictor thumbnail cache keeps resurfacing because two of the four prod nodes drifted from the approved config. Someone hand-edited eviction settings during the last incident and never reverted. Do not hand-edit again. Pull the repo, run the sync script, confirm all nodes match before closing. Symptoms of drift: RSS climbing past 6 GB within a day, evictions near zero. The canonical settings every node must carry are the following.

settings of tagef-bawif:
DRUIX_HOST=druix.zemvarlabs.internal
DRUIX_PORT=8000

# Turnstile counter config for Larkspur Stadium (Gatewise v3).
# Quick note for the sync: counts drift if the gates lose network,
# so we reconcile every 10 minutes against the entry log. Don't
# touch the debounce value — 250ms is the sweet spot. The reconciler
# writes to the database defined right below.

replica DSN, yahaf-yagaf: mongodb://tamath_svc:a2netSk3RZMuTj@db-d084.novacsoft.internal:5432/ralmir

ChipGate reader onboarding. The mat units at the Larkvale Marathon feed raw RFID pings to the SplitSync collector over serial. Flash firmware only from the vetted image; field units brick easily. Poll interval is 200ms — do not lower it. Logs rotate hourly on the reader itself. To push results upstream, SplitSync needs the ingest service key, shown below.

gateway credential: kto3_qfe